Baby's Day Out is a 1994 American adventure comedy film directed by Patrick Read Johnson and written by John Hughes, who also served as producer.Starring Joe Mantegna, Lara Flynn Boyle, Joe Pantoliano, and Brian Haley, the film centers on a wealthy baby's abduction by three criminals, his subsequent escape and adventure through Chicago while being pursued by the criminals.

Patrick Read Johnson (born May 7, 1962) is an American filmmaker, special effects artist and screenwriter.Born in Wadsworth, Illinois, he is best known for his directorial work on the films Spaced Invaders, Angus, Baby's Day Out, The Genesis Code and 5-25-77.

Ek Phool Teen Kante (transl. One flower three thorns) is a 1997 Indian Hindi-language comedy film directed by Anup Malik and produced by Deven Tanna. It stars Vikas Bhalla, Sadashiv Amrapurkar, Kader Khan and Monica Bedi in pivotal roles. [1]
